Rave Restaurant Group Reports Strong Financial Results for Q3 Fiscal 2024

Author:

Rave Restaurant Group, Inc. has announced its financial results for the third quarter of fiscal 2024, showcasing strong performance and continued profitability. The company reported a net income of $0.7 million for the quarter, a significant increase compared to the same period in the prior year.

The income before taxes also saw a notable improvement, rising by 95.2% to $0.9 million. Despite challenging market conditions, total revenue remained stable at $3.0 million. Adjusted EBITDA increased by $0.2 million to $0.8 million, further highlighting the company’s financial strength.

While Pizza Inn domestic comparable store retail sales experienced a slight decrease of 1.9%, the company remains optimistic due to the impressive growth in the previous year’s third quarter. Additionally, Pie Five domestic comparable store retail sales decreased by 6.4%, but it is important to note the previous year’s strong performance.

Rave Restaurant Group attributes its success to its experienced executive team and their strategic initiatives. By restructuring the team, the company has been able to bring in industry experts, resulting in overall improvements and cost savings. This, along with focused financial strategies, has positioned the company for continued growth and increased value for shareholders.

CEO Brandon Solano emphasized the commitment to invest in reimaging and marketing programs. The company plans to revitalize existing Pizza Inn restaurants, as well as open new franchised restaurants. Through these efforts, Rave Restaurant Group expects to see double-digit same-store sales increases.

Newly hired Chief Financial Officer Jay Rooney expressed enthusiasm for joining the Rave team during this crucial time. Rooney commended the company’s focus on controlling expenses and generating over $1 million in operating cash for the quarter. He emphasized the growth potential in revitalizing existing restaurants and opening new ones.
